Here are the 10 frontend trends we're tracking closely in 2026, validated through real client work. React is getting its own compiler, and it alters how we approach optimisation. For years, we have actually been manually adding useMemo and useCallback hooks throughout our code, attempting to keep performance in check. It's laborious work that breaks flow and clutters codebases.
Think about it as having a performance professional examining your code behind the scenes, optimising rendering without you raising a finger. Meta's currently using it internally, and by 2026, it's offered for everybody. The real win? Less time debugging efficiency problems, cleaner code, and more mental space to focus on building functions that in fact matter to users.
70% of developers are currently utilizing or preparing to utilize AI coding assistants. These aren't just autocomplete tools any longer. AI-first development environments expect architectural decisions, suggest performance improvements, and manage whole features with very little assistance. GitHub Copilot and Cursor AI are ending up being real advancement partners instead of expensive text prediction.
AI accelerates the grunt work, but strategic choices about architecture, user experience, and scalability still need human judgement. Start with AI assistants on recurring taskscomponent boilerplate, test writing, paperwork. Build trust slowly before delegating more complex architectural decisions. By 2026, video editors, 3D modelling tools, and games run straight in web browsers with performance that equals native applications. The implications go beyond video gaming. Image processing, data analysis, scientific simulations, jobs that as soon as needed desktop software application now work in an internet browser tab. This opens possibilities for tools that are instantly accessible without installation friction.

A subtle animation when hovering over a button, the way a notification gently appears, how aspects shift between states, these micro-interactions define how an interface feels. In our A/B testing program with a large seller, we tested variations of item card designs and filter behaviour. The sticky filter execution that won consisted of thoroughly tuned micro-interactions, a subtle emphasize when filters applied, smooth transitions when results upgraded.
